Heap Leaching

noun

Pronunciation: /hiːp ˈliːtʃɪŋ/

An ore processing method where crushed ore is stacked in heaps and treated with chemical solvents that percolate through the material to extract valuable minerals, leaving behind residual waste rock. The resulting leachate and spent ore pose significant environmental reclamation challenges including contamination risk.

Plain English

Mining ore is stacked in piles and sprayed with chemicals to extract metals, leaving toxic waste behind.

Frequently Asked Questions

What environmental issues result from abandoned heap leach operations?

Contaminated leachate seepage, acidification of groundwater, and unstable waste rock piles threaten ecosystems.

How is a heap leach site reclaimed?

Containment systems, leachate capture, waste stabilization, and capping or vegetation are typical remediation approaches.
